### Validators plugin system — on-call notes (Hollowpine)

Validators load as plugins at startup; a bad one fails closed, so ingestion halts rather than passing dirty data. If paged, check the plugin registry log first — nine times out of ten it's an unsigned plugin. Plugins must be signed before loading, using the key below.

release key, fahaf-bajof: bky3_Xam

# Tramline Survey — Environments

Tramline's field-survey service runs three environments: sandbox, staging, and production. Plugin authors should target sandbox, which fully exercises offline mode — queued submissions, local map tiles, and deferred sync all behave as on devices in the field. Staging mirrors production sync windows; don't rely on it for offline testing. Each environment exposes the same hook surface. The sandbox environment uses the following settings.

settings of fafog-haduf:
ZORIX_PIN=4648
ZORIX_METRICS_HOST=metrics.zorix.paliqsys.corp
ZORIX_LOG_LEVEL=info
ZORIX_TENANT=druix

## Changelog — Font vendoring defaults changed

As of this release, the Bracken UI build no longer fetches third-party fonts at build time. All typefaces used by the Lanternwell suite are now vendored into the repo under a dedicated assets directory, and the fetch step is skipped by default. If you're onboarding, nothing to install — the fonts travel with the checkout. The build flags controlling this behavior are listed below.

settings of hadup-yafog:
LAMAEL_PIN=3761
LAMAEL_TENANT=istmir
LAMAEL_METRICS_HOST=metrics.lamael.plorvasys.test
LAMAEL_SEAL=seal_8ea68500
LAMAEL_STANDBY_TEAM=fraok